you should try:
adb shell setprop persist.tegra.OGL_ThreadControl 0x01
and also forcing the GPU to be in high performance mode.
But only some games will improve because of this changes.

That is a persistent setting that sticks around even after reboot. This enables the Nvidia driver to run on a secondary thread, as similar to what it does in Windows.
Linux/Android this has to be enabled manually since it may cause issues randomly.
Setting the option of high performance mode in the settings isn't enough to force the GPU in to a high performance rendering mode. You've actually got to manually disable GPU clock scaling, otherwise the GPU will only run ~200Mhz instead of its full 1Ghz.

It definitely does make a difference in performance.
I force the clockspeed of the device to the max constantly.
This ADB command can't physically brick the device, and actually it is a bit wrong since it needs to run as root.
Something like this.
adb shell su -c "setprop persist.tegra.OGL_ThreadControl 0x01"
